What is Bixby?

Bixby is Samsung’s proprietary virtual assistant, designed to make interactions with Samsung devices smoother and more intuitive. Launched in March 2017, Bixby aims to provide a personalized user experience by enabling users to complete tasks, manage settings, and obtain information through voice, touch, and visual commands.

The Three Pillars of Bixby

Bixby is often described through its three core functionalities:

  • Bixby Voice: Allows users to control their device using voice commands.
  • Bixby Vision: Employs the camera to recognize objects, extracting information, and offering contextual actions.
  • Bixby Routines: Automates everyday tasks by creating customizable routines based on user habits.

These features exemplify Bixby’s robust capabilities, making it not just a tool for searching the web but a versatile assistant that adapts to individual user needs.

List of Samsung Phones with Bixby

Since its launch, Bixby has been integrated into a variety of Samsung smartphones. Here is a comprehensive list of the major Samsung phone models that support Bixby:

  • Galaxy S Series:
ModelRelease Year
Galaxy S82017
Galaxy S8+2017
Galaxy S92018
Galaxy S9+2018
Galaxy S10e2019
Galaxy S102019
Galaxy S10+2019
Galaxy S202020
Galaxy S20+2020
Galaxy S20 Ultra2020
Galaxy S212021
Galaxy S21+2021
Galaxy S21 Ultra2021
Galaxy S222022
Galaxy S22+2022
Galaxy S22 Ultra2022
  • Galaxy Note Series:
ModelRelease Year
Galaxy Note82017
Galaxy Note92018
Galaxy Note102019
Galaxy Note10+2019
Galaxy Note202020
Galaxy Note20 Ultra2020

Galaxy A Series

Samsung’s Galaxy A series also features a selection of models that come equipped with Bixby, designed to cater to a broader audience while still delivering decent specs and performance.

  • Galaxy A40
  • Galaxy A50
  • Galaxy A70
  • Galaxy A80
  • Galaxy A90
  • Galaxy A51
  • Galaxy A71
  • Galaxy A32
  • Galaxy A52
  • Galaxy A72

Other Models

Bixby is not limited to flagship and mid-range devices. Other Samsung devices that support Bixby include:

  • Galaxy Fold
  • Galaxy Z Flip

These innovative foldable phones fully integrate Bixby’s features, harnessing the potential of the large screens.

How to Access and Use Bixby on Samsung Phones

Using Bixby is stra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to access and utilize the features of Bixby on your Samsung device.

Setting Up Bixby

  1. Activate Bixby: Depending on your device, you can either press the Bixby button (if available) or swipe right from the home screen to access Bixby.
  2. Setup Process: Follow the on-screen instructions to log in with your Samsung account or create one if needed.
  3. Permissions: Grant Bixby the necessary permissions to access your device’s features, such as location and contacts.

Utilizing Bixby’s Features

To harness the full potential of Bixby, here are the commands you can use:

Voice Commands

Simply say “Hi Bixby” followed by your command. For instance, you can say:
– “Hi Bixby, set a reminder for my meeting tomorrow at 10 AM.”
– “Hi Bixby, what’s the weather like today?”

Bixby Vision

To use Bixby Vision, open the camera app and select the corresponding icon. Aim your camera at objects or text, and Bixby will provide information, translation, or shopping options instantly.

Bixby Routines

You can set Bixby Routines to streamline your daily activities by automating tasks. For example, you can create a routine where Bixby automatically turns on Do Not Disturb mode and sets an alarm for 7 AM when you exit the office.

How can I activate Bixby on my Samsung phone?

Activating Bixby on your Samsung phone is simple and can be done in a few ways. The most common method is through the dedicated Bixby button found on many models. Pressing this button will launch Bixby, and you can begin issuing voice commands immediately. Alternatively, you can access Bixby by swiping right on the home screen to reach the Bixby homepage.

If your phone does not have a dedicated button, you can access Bixby by downloading the latest version of the Bixby app from the Galaxy Store. Once installed, open the app and follow the on-screen instructions to set up your preferences and voice enhancements. Enabling voice activation will also allow you to wake Bixby with phrases like “Hi Bixby.”
